How much do customer service representative teladoc j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for customer service representative teladoc in the United States is $18.80,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$20.91 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Customer Service Representative at Teladoc do?

A Customer Service Representative at Teladoc assists members with their healthcare needs by answering questions, scheduling appointments, and providing information about Teladoc's virtual care services. They handle inquiries via phone, chat, or email, ensuring a positive member experience. Representatives also help troubleshoot technical issues, verify patient information, and guide users through the process of connecting with healthcare professionals.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Customer Service Representative at Teladoc,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Customer Service Representative at Teladoc, you need strong commun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) software, call center platforms, and basic telehealth systems is typically required. Patience, empathy, and the ability to manage stressful situations are crucial soft skills for excelling in this role. These skills ensure that patients receive timely, accurate, and compassionate support, which is vital for maintaining trust and satisfaction in a healthcare-focused environment.

What is the difference between Customer Service Representative Teladoc vs Customer Support Specialist Teladoc?

AspectCustomer Service Representative TeladocCustomer Support Specialist Teladoc
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; training providedHigh school diploma or equivalent; specialized training optional
Work EnvironmentRemote or call center setting, handling patient inquiriesRemote or call center, providing technical and service support
Employer & IndustryTelehealth services, healthcare industryTelehealth services, healthcare industry

Customer Service Representatives Teladoc primarily handle patient inquiries, appointment scheduling, and billing issues, focusing on customer interaction. Customer Support Specialists Teladoc often provide technical support, troubleshooting, and assist with platform navigation. While both roles require strong communication skills and healthcare knowledge, their focus areas differ slightly, with the former centered on customer service and the latter on technical support.

How does a Customer Service Representative at Teladoc typically collaborate with healthcare providers and other internal teams?

As a Customer Service Representative at Teladoc, you'll frequently work alongside healthcare providers, technical support, and insurance coordinators to resolve patient inquiries efficiently. Collaboration often involves relaying patient information, clarifying appointment logistics, and ensuring a seamless virtual care experience. Clear communication and teamwork are essential, as you may need to coordinate follow-ups or troubleshoot issues with multiple departments, all while maintaining patient confidentiality and a high standard of service.
